Burke, Lillian was born on November 26, 1951 in Lansing, Michigan, United States.

Bachelor, Macalester College, 1974; Bachelor of Science, University of Minnesota, 1975; Doctor of Medicine, University of Minnesota, 1979.
Resident, U. Alabama, Birmingham, 1979-1982;
physician, private practice, Auburn, New York, 1983-1990;
medical reviewer, Food and Drug Administration, Rockville, Maryland., 1995-1997;
private practice, since 1997. Instructor medicine State University of New York, Syracuse, 1984-1987, assistant professor, 1988-1990. Clinical faculty Georgetown University, 1995-1996.
Adjunct assistant professor department medicine Dartmouth U., since 1996.
Leader Girl Scouts American, St. Paul, 1969-1972. Member American College of Physicians, American Association Cancer Research, American Federation Clinical Research, American Society Clinical Pharmacology and Therapeutics.
